Emergency response to the needs of internally displaced persons (IDPs) in four sites in the Metropolitan Area of ​​Port-au-Prince

Haiti Humanitarian Action
January 2025
April 2025

This project aims to reduce the vulnerability of displaced populations in four sites by improving access to drinking water and sanitation, thus helping to mitigate the impacts of the ongoing humanitarian and health crisis. Key objectives include supporting four IDP sites, carrying out one drain per site (a total of four) and nine watertrucking deliveries per site, including six of drinking water and three of general use water.
